1. What is topography of the ocean?

1. Topography-the surface features of the ocean floor.

2. FeaturesA. Continental Shelf

-Slopes gently down from the edge of a continent

b. Continental Slope

Slopes steeply from the continental shelf

It is the base of the continental slope and is made of large piles of sediment.

C. Continental Rise

D. Submarine Canyon

Steep V shaped canyon that cuts through the continental shelf and continental slope

E. Abyssal Plain

Flat ocean bottom covered with mud and the remains of marine organisms

F. Seamount Steep walled, pointy, extinct volcano

The seamount’s shown here can reach up to just under 600 ft. of the surface. They are located off the coast of Alaska.

G. Guyot

Flat topped seamount flattened by the action of waves

H. Mid-Ocean Ridge

Longest Undersea mountain range Occurs at divergent boundaries

Oceanic Ridges

I. Rift Valley

Deep valley that forms between the mountains of a mid-ocean ridge

J. Trench Steep sided narrow cut in the sea floor Deepest part of the ocean (Mariana Trench) Formed from convergent plate boundaries
